Chapter 18 -   The endeavor for Liberation - Slokas - 18, 19.

ज्ञानं ज्ञेयं परिज्ञाता त्रिविधा कर्मचोदना ।
करणं कर्म कर्तेति त्रिविधः कर्मसङ्ग्रहः ॥ १८-१८॥

ज्ञानं कर्म च कर्ता च त्रिधैव गुणभेदतः ।
प्रोच्यते गुणसङ्ख्याने यथावच्छृणु तान्यपि ॥ १८-१९॥

nyaanam jnyeyam parijnyaataa trividhaa karmachodanaa ।
karanam karma karteti trividhah’ karmasangrahah’ ॥ 18-18 ॥

nyaanam karma cha kartaa cha tridhaiva gunabhedatah’ ।
prochyate gunasankhyaane yathaavachchhri’nu taanyapi ॥ 18-19 ॥

Knowledge, object of knowledge and the knower all three are self-restrainers of any action. The organs of action, the act itself and the doer are three ways of gathering actions.

Listen also to that, what is exactly declared about the difference in the attributes of the triad namely the knowledge, the action and the doer in the theories of attributes.
